French Deploy 3 Rafale Fighter Jets to Poland, Citing Russia Threat

French President Emmanuel Macron announced on September 11 the deployment of three Rafale fighter jets to Poland, in a show of support for the eastern European country amid rising tensions with Russia. This deployment aims to strengthen Poland's defense amid civilian preparations for war.

With growing fears of Russian aggression, thousands of Poles are joining civilian defense groups and volunteering for military training to bolster national defense. This deployment of French fighter jets to Poland is a clear signal of solidarity and support from France in the face of potential threats.

This action reflects the ongoing strengthening of relations between France and Poland, as well as other Baltic states, who are increasingly concerned about Russian aggression. The three Rafale jets, currently based in Leeuwarden in the Netherlands, are expected to arrive in Poland in the coming days, although the specific timeline has not been disclosed for security reasons.
